St. Martinville - A Funeral Service will be held at 3:00 pm on Wednesday, September 18, 2024 at Pellerin Funeral Home in St. Martinville for Jimmie Dale Green Guidry, 70, who passed away on Sunday, September 15, 2024 in Lafayette.
A visitation will take place at the funeral home in St. Martinville on Wednesday from 8:30 am until the time of service at 3:00 pm.
Jimmie Dale worked for the State of Louisiana for over 30 years, giving time to both the DOTD and Public Health divisions. After retirement, she worked for several years for St. Bernard School's after care program. Jimmie Dale was a devoted mother and grandmother, who cherished the time she spent with them. She enjoyed gardening, doing yard work, listening to music and caring for her dog, Lily. Jimmie Dale will be greatly missed by all who knew and loved her.
She is survived by her daughter, Jessica Hulin and her husband, Logan; grandchildren, Kalli Hulin and Khloe Hulin; brother, Terry Wayne Green; and sisters, Jeanette Jones and Charlotte Burnaman and her husband, Steve.
She is preceded in death by her father, Jesse "Jimmy" Green; and mother, Fay Juneau Green.
